Smart City Pet Insurance Integration Cost Analysis by State and Breed

The cost of Smart City Pet Insurance Integration depends on several factors: your pet’s breed, age, location, and the level of coverage you choose. On average, monthly premiums range from $15 for basic accident-only plans to $70 for comprehensive coverage. For example, insuring a 3-year-old Maine Coon in California may cost $35 per month, while a French Bulldog in New York could be $60 due to higher veterinary costs and breed risk. Deductibles typically range from $100 to $1,000, with lower deductibles resulting in higher monthly premiums. State-by-state analysis shows that pet insurance is most expensive in California, New York, and Florida, while states like Ohio and Texas offer lower rates. Real claim payout data reveals that Lemonade paid out an average of $2,300 per claim in 2025, while Trupanion’s average was $2,800, reflecting their higher reimbursement rates. According to the North American Pet Health Insurance Association, the national average for accident and illness coverage is $48.66 per month for dogs and $28.57 for cats. Comparing Top Providers: Lemonade vs Healthy Paws vs Trupanion vs ASPCA

Choosing the right provider for Smart City Pet Insurance Integration means weighing cost, coverage, claims process, and customer reviews. Lemonade stands out for its low premiums, fast AI-powered claims, and seamless digital experience. Healthy Paws offers unlimited annual payouts and is praised for quick reimbursements, though premiums rise with age. Trupanion is unique for its direct vet payment system and 90% reimbursement rate, making it ideal for high-cost emergencies. ASPCA provides flexible deductibles and wellness add-ons, but has lower annual limits and slower claims processing. Real customer reviews highlight Lemonade’s user-friendly app and Healthy Paws’ responsive support. However, some users report frustration with ASPCA’s customer service and Trupanion’s waiting periods. Provider Comparison

Pet Insurance Provider Comparison for Smart City Pet Insurance Integration - 2026
ProviderMonthly CostDeductibleReimbursementAnnual Limit
Lemonade $15-40$100-50070-90%$5k-100k
Healthy Paws $20-50$100-50070-90%Unlimited
Trupanion $30-70$0-100090%Unlimited
ASPCA $18-45$100-50070-90%$5k-10k
Data compiled from official provider websites. Prices may vary by location, pet age, and breed. Last updated: February 2026.

Are there any Smart City Pet Insurance Integration that cover pre-existing conditions?

Most Smart City Pet Insurance Integration plans do not cover pre-existing conditions, but some offer limited coverage after a waiting period. Trupanion and ASPCA may cover certain curable conditions if your pet has been symptom-free for a set time. Always read the fine print and ask your provider about specific exclusions and waiting periods.

What is not covered by Smart City Pet Insurance Integration?

Smart City Pet Insurance Integration typically does not cover pre-existing conditions, elective procedures, or cosmetic treatments. Exclusions may include dental cleanings, breeding costs, and certain hereditary conditions. Always review your policy’s exclusions and ask your provider for a full list before enrolling.
